Buzz Droids
During Episode III buzz droids appeared during one scene but they made quite an impact on the ships they latched onto. The Buzz Droids were launched from the rockets after they passed the starfighter and began tearing it apart upon impact.
http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=1AxvxP18BhU (End of video)
I'm wondering if something like this would be possible to mod in Star Wars Battlefront II.
1. Rockets fly past the starfighters and explode launching buzz droids
2. Launched buzz droids attach to hard points on the various starships (Like fire or smoke)
3. Buzz Droids begin to lower the health of the starfighters emitting sparks (I can do that)

Re: Buzz Droids
You know what, you aren't too far off from the way I think it could be done. Here's how I believe it would work:
-Missile explodes into chunks after a certain time interval, the chunks looking like the buzz droid balls.
-Have the explosion ordnance be an emmiter ordnance, with smolder in effect.
-Have a smoldering effect on the ship in the shape of buzz droids (effects can be objects, as evidenced by the force pummel attack in Dark Times)

Re: Buzz Droids
Actually, instead of sticky grenades, you could use a beacon - yes, they can stick onto things, and you can just make the aim distance like 1.0 or 0.1 or something - that fires an emitter ordnance that deals smolder damage!

Re: Buzz Droids
Sticky Grenade seems to be the best way of doing it. I could use "com_weap_veh_fly_torpedo" to have them be lockable. They launch in their compressed mode and upon impact they unfold and adhere to the ship. As Willinator suggested they could cause incremental damage over time. Instead of explosions effect I could simply use the spark effect. After their lifespan expires they disappear. I really appreciate all the feedback guys, incredibly helpful! 
I think it should be relatively easy to create the odf for this, I'll see what I can do. The hardest part would be creating the buzz droid model. Loopy53 would you be up to the challenge? (Doesn't need to be this detailed)

Re: Buzz Droids
If you want to drop more than one at a time add these lines to the weapon odf:
Just change SalvoCount to the amount wanted
Code: Select all
SalvoCount = "1"
SalvoDelay = "0.0"
InitialSalvoDelay = "0.51"
SalvoTime = "0.0"-
